About the role
Senior Financial AccountantSydney CBD | Up to $140K + SuperAn outstanding opportunity has arisen for a commercially minded Senior Financial Accountant to join a highly regarded ASX-listed property organisation with a strong market reputation, premium asset portfolio and an exceptional workplace culture.Reporting to a Finance Manager and working closely with senior stakeholders across the business, this role offers a broad mix of financial reporting, tax, audit coordination and business partnering responsibilities. It is ideally suited to a high-performing accountant looking to make their second move from professional practice or take the next step from a Financial Accountant position into a more senior and commercially focused role.This is an organisation known for developing talent, providing genuine mentorship and offering clear career progression pathways within a collaborative and high-performing finance team.Key Responsibilities:
Financial & Statutory ReportingPrepare monthly, quarterly and annual financial reports for multiple entities within the group.Assist with ASX reporting requirements, including half-year and year-end reporting processes.Prepare and review balance sheet reconciliations and supporting schedules.Ensure compliance with relevant accounting standards and corporate policies.Support budgeting, forecasting and cash flow reporting activities.Tax & CompliancePrepare and review BAS, IAS and other indirect tax obligations.Assist with income tax calculations and tax effect accounting.Liaise with external tax advisors on compliance and advisory matters.Monitor changes in accounting and tax legislation and assess business impacts.Audit & ControlsCoordinate external audit processes and manage auditor requests.Assist in the preparation of audit files and technical accounting papers.Support the ongoing enhancement of financial controls, policies and procedures.Ensure compliance with internal governance frameworks and risk requirements.Business PartneringPartner with asset management, property, operations and commercial teams across the business.Provide financial insights and analysis to support decision-making.Assist with investment, development and acquisition-related financial analysis.Support stakeholders with budgeting, forecasting and performance reporting.Process ImprovementIdentify opportunities to improve reporting efficiency and financial processes.Participate in finance transformation and systems enhancement initiatives.Contribute to continuous improvement projects across the finance function.About YouTo be successful in this role, you will bring:CA or CPA qualification (CA highly regarded).4–7 years' accounting experience.A background in Audit, Business Services or Financial Accounting.Experience within property, real estate, funds management or a listed environment will be highly regarded.Strong technical accounting and financial reporting capability.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ills.A proactive and commercially minded approach.Advanced Excel skills and experience working with large ERP systems.Why Join?Join a leading ASX-listed property organisation with an exceptional reputation.Broad and varied role across reporting, tax, audit and commercial finance.Strong mentorship from experienced finance leaders.Clear career development and progression opportunities.Excellent culture with a collaborative and supportive team environment.Prime Sydney CBD offices with flexible working arrangements.Attractive salary package of up to $140K + Super.This is an excellent opportunity for an ambitious accountant seeking a genuine stepping stone into a broader senior finance position within a high-quality organisation that actively invests in the development of its people.
